Financial engineering is defined as the application of mathematical methods to the solution of problems in finance. The recent financial crisis raised many challenges for financial engineers: not only were financially engineered products such as collateralized debt obligations and credit default swaps implicated in causing the crisis, but the risk management techniques developed by financial engineers appeared to fail when they were most desperately needed. The field of Information Systems has been shifting from an 'immersion view', which relies on the immersion of information technology (IT) as part of the business environment, to a 'fusion view' in which IT is fused within the business environment, forming a unified fabric that integrates work and personal life, as well as personal and public information. In the context of this fusion view, decision support systems should achieve a total alignment with the context and the personal preferences of users. "Health systems worldwide are under increasing pressure to deliver services in an efficient and cost-effective manner. Telehealth, or the delivery of health services at a distance, has an important role to play in achieving this. Communication technologies are becoming more readily accessible and affordable, and an array of telehealth applications are emerging which have potential benefits for patients and clinicians, particularly in areas where health services are traditionally limited, non-existent or difficult to access. This book presents papers selected from contributions to the 2nd International Conference on Global Telehealth, held in Sydney, Australia, in November 2012. The theme of the conference was delivering quality healthcare anywhere through telehealth, and the papers collected here are those in keeping with this theme. They are also deemed to have a lasting value and capture the international diversity and variations of scope in contemporary telehealth developments. The contributions in this book cover a broad spectrum, ranging from 'work in progress' laboratory studies to successfully established clinical services, and will be of interest to all those concerned with improving the provision of healthcare worldwide"--Publisher's description.
